Masked intrigue
The Beauty of the Spirits exhibition showcases elaborate masks, which come from a wealth of African, Asian, American and Oceanian collections, at the Paris-based Quai Branly museum.
The exhibits bear witness to stunning creativity in the use of a range of materials, including leather, porcelain, jade, vine and plastic, and the mastery of handicraft skills such as weaving, carving, embroidering and color painting. They cast a light on a normally unseen world.
Opening times: 9 am-5 pm, no entrance after 4 pm, closed on Mondays, until Aug 16. National Museum of China, east of Tian'anmen Square, 16 East Chang'an Avenue, Beijing. 010-6511-6400.
